1. The Royal Touch: Silk Velvet - The Original Luxe 🦋

When you think of velvet, you might picture the opulent fabrics of royal courts. And you’d be right! Silk velvet is the granddaddy of all velvets, known for its sumptuous feel and rich appearance. Made from natural silk fibers, this fabric is not only soft but also has a natural sheen that catches the light beautifully. 🌈
Fun fact: Silk velvet has been a symbol of wealth and status since the Middle Ages, often reserved for royalty and nobility. If you want to feel like a king or queen, silk velvet is your go-to. 👑

2. The Modern Marvel: Synthetic Velvet - Affordable Elegance 🛍️

While silk velvet is the epitome of luxury, it can be quite pricey. Enter synthetic velvet, a more affordable alternative that doesn’t skimp on style. Made from materials like polyester, rayon, and nylon, synthetic velvet offers the same plush texture and drape as its natural counterpart. 🧶
Pro tip: High-quality synthetic velvets can be almost indistinguishable from silk. Look for blends that include a mix of synthetic and natural fibers for the best of both worlds. 🧐

3. The Eco-Friendly Choice: Sustainable Velvet - Green and Glamorous 🌱

In an era where sustainability is key, many brands are turning to eco-friendly options. Sustainable velvet is made from materials like recycled polyester, organic cotton, and Tencel. These fabrics not only reduce environmental impact but also offer a luxurious feel that’s gentle on the planet. 🌍
Did you know? Tencel, derived from wood pulp, is biodegradable and has a smooth, silky texture that’s perfect for velvet. It’s a win-win for fashion and the environment! 🎉
